Seeking an Alternative Delivery Design Project Manager with the ability to lead engineering teams in our growing Alternative Delivery practice in Transportation.

The ideal candidate will have alternative delivery experience within the transportation community and a history of operational success.

You will be expected to support the design process through the project, overseeing and directing technical resources, monitoring the technical aspects of the project, coordinating with contractors and owners and perform design management functions through construction.

Our Transportation Alternative Delivery practice spans across multiple partner firms, including Horrocks Engineers, DRMP, HMB and Rinker Design Associates.

You will have the opportunity to leverage more than 4,000 staff in these firms to deliver any type and facet of Alternative Delivery projects (including traditional DB, progressive DB, GEC, Program Manager, etc.) across the United States.

Key Responsibilities

  • The candidate will have proven experience in identifying, directing and managing pre-award and post-award services for design-build projects.
  • Proven experience in transportation including highways, roadways, transit and bridges; experience in other service sectors is also of interest (i.e. water, wastewater).
  • Works with other managers, project engineers, and discipline leads to develop budgets, schedules, and plans for the various elements of a project.

Ensures that the project meets or exceeds goals established in these plans.

Serves as the primary client liaison and manages the project team to deliver the scope, schedule, and budgets to completion and to the client's satisfaction.

Leads client contract scoping and negotiations.

  • Performs technical discipline tasks including analysis, reports, design, specification, and production for assigned projects.
  • Mobilize company resources, through coordination with technical groups or partner firms, to create project teams capable of completing effective, quality work.
  • Proven ability to successfully manage large, multi-discipline assignments is required.
  • Participate in development and negotiation of teaming agreements between both builders and subconsultants ensuring that protocols and standards for commercial and risk terms are achieved.
  • Facilitate work planning activity, oversee pre-award fee development, profitability analysis, cash management, quality management, and risk / change management.
  • Ensure that project controls measures are implemented. Schedule and conduct periodic project reviews to oversee and facilitate successful project delivery performance.
  • Oversee development of post-award scope, schedule and fee development.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

About Trilon

Trilon was formed with the vision of building the next Top 20 infrastructure consulting firm in North America by bringing together some of the nation's best infrastructure consulting firms, focused on delivering practical and sustainable infrastructure solutions.

Trilon is backed by Alpine Investors, a PeopleFirst Private Equity Firm. Trilon currently comprises 4,500+ staff across the US.
